AT&T Hooks Up With 1-800-FLOWERS for Valentine’s Day

1800flowers
AT&T and 1-800-FLOWERS are seeing a greenish-red this year for Valentine’s Day. The largest GSM carrier in the United States has added a link to the 1-800-FLOWERS mobile shop to its MediaNET deck, as part of their ‘Cupid Goes Wireless’ campaign. AT&T subscribers can login to send their special someone a free animated flower bouquet (hopefully with a disclaimer for men that mobile flowers will not cover them for the entire holiday).

There’s also a contest to win a $50 gift pack from 1-800-FLOWERS.com. This is obviously great for 1-800-FLOWERS to have exposure on AT&T’s MediaNET homepage, as its currently the default homepage for the mobile browser on most of AT&T’s 65+million subscriber’s handsets.

SMS Text News sends flowers to Stephen Fry

untitled-6

Every week we send flowers to someone in or connected with the mobile industry. No specific reason, other than because we think they’re deserving. Last week the recipient was Paul Magelli who’d just sold his company to Nokia. Previous to that, it was Hugh from mobile messaging giant, MBlox.

This week we thought comedian, writer, actor, humourist, novelist, columnist, filmmaker, television personality AND mobile geek, Stephen Fry, deserved a visit from the SMS Text News Flower Fairy!

He outed himself as a 100% Class-A geek last September with this post on his newly introduced blog dissecting the apparent magnificence of the Apple iPhone. I’m a huge fan — and was thus delighted to find that he was thoroughly well informed when it came to wireless and technology issues. The post was so well received that The Guardian newspaper phoned him up and they’ve now got him writing on technology each week (”Welcome to Dork Talk“, definitely worth a read).
